Scout report

Experienced headCentral defender

J. Stones is a 32-year-old central defender at Manchester City, rated 26.7 overall by Field Insider's model. A seasoned veteran, he has been a fringe squad member this season (17.8% of available minutes). His defensive output reads 2 tackles, blocks and interceptions per 90. Below: strengths, watch-points, market-value outlook and the latest transfer news on Stones.

On the season, Stones graded 11 for current form (age-blind), on 2 clean sheets and 2.004 defensive actions per 90.

Year-on-year, that's broadly in line with last season (Season 8 → 11). Over the 6 seasons on record his form has drifted down, peaking in 2020/21.

On long-term talent our Rating reads 27. At 32 Stones is into the veteran stage, where the age curve weighs on the projection, and a market index of 12.8 reflects that trajectory.

Read the appearance count in context: Stones missed 10 games through injury (thigh, muscle bruise, injury) out of roughly 38 this season. The 9 he did play is a solid return on the time he was fit, and his ratings are weighted toward those games rather than the ones he sat out injured.
